You won't find any vintage, game-used (well, one), or cuts here. What you will find are base, inserts, parallels, and reprints - especially those of 1952 Topps #311.
Apart from him being a 500 HR Club member, there's something else that draws me to the Mick. It wasn't his personal lifestyle (a drunk and a womanizer), but rather my family history. My late father was a collector - he had Ruth, Robinson, Gehrig, Mantle, etc. However, before I was born his collection was destroyed in a fire. There's one card my mother always told me about - his 1952 Topps #311 RC. My father passed when I was six months old in 1987 - this card and this hobby connect me to a man I never got to know.
Right now, I'm going after any reprint of the 1952 Topps Mantle. I also have a small collection of other Mantle base and inserts I've acquired. I'll show them off here. First of all, what better way to start than with each '52 reprint I own (minus two - one porcelain and another I got in today that isn't scanned).
1996 Topps Mantle Collection '52 reprint
2006 Topps '52 #311 (black background)
2007 Turkey Red #117
2010 Topps Cards Your Mom Threw Out #1
In the mail today was a 2007 Topps '52 #7, which is very similar in design to the 2006 Topps '52.
